what number should i set for my maytag refrigerator
Setting the right temperature for your Maytag refrigerator depends on the specific model and your food storage needs. However, as a general guideline, a recommended starting point is to set the refrigerator temperature to 37°F (2.8°C) and the freezer temperature to 0°F (-18°C). These temperatures are typically considered safe and suitable for most households. Here's why these temperatures are commonly recommended: Refrigerator Compartment: A temperature of 37°F (2.8°C) ensures that perishable foods, such as fruits, vegetables, dairy products, and meats, are kept at an appropriate temperature to slow down bacterial growth and maintain freshness. The slightly higher setting compared to the standard 35°F-38°F range allows for a small buffer zone and prevents the temperature from getting too close to 40°F (4.4°C), which is the point where bacteria can multiply more rapidly. Freezer Compartment: A temperature of 0°F (-18°C) is ideal for freezing and storing frozen foods. At this temperature, the growth of bacteria is effectively halted, preserving the quality and safety of frozen items. However, it's essential to keep in mind that these are general recommendations, and some Maytag refrigerator models may have specific temperature settings or features. Some refrigerators come with digital displays that allow you to set the exact temperature you desire for each compartment. To determine the precise temperature settings for your particular Maytag refrigerator, refer to the user manual that came with the appliance. The manual will provide detailed instructions on how to adjust the temperature and may include specific recommendations for different types of foods. Additionally, consider your personal preferences and needs when setting the refrigerator temperature. If you find that some areas of the refrigerator are too cold or too warm, you can make minor adjustments to achieve the desired conditions. Regularly monitor the internal temperature using a refrigerator thermometer to ensure it remains within safe ranges and adjust the settings as needed to maintain food freshness and safety.
